Overview

The University of Edinburgh (the Buyer) invites competitive tenders for the supply and delivery of an e-beam metal evaporation (typically Ti/Pt/Al/Zinc) system capable of depositing a range of metals and oxides (including Al2O3) from four pockets with distance between source and target sufficient for good lift off processing. The supplier will install and commission the e-beam evaporator at the Scottish Microelectronics Centre.
